Agribazaar Launches Kisan Safalta Card for Agri Financing

Agribazaar is a private sector electronic Agri mandi, launched ‘Agribazaar Kisan Safalta Card’. The Agribazaar Kisan Safalta Card is a quick and easy way to help farmers to meet their pre- and post-harvest farm requirements and allied expenses. Farmers can use Agribazaar Kisan Safalta Card to get financing. The funds provided can only be used to buy farm inputs and requirements.

Key Points related to Agribazaar Kisan Safalta Card

  • The card has a 12-month repayment period, which provides enough time to pay off the balance.
  • The crop yield of each farmer determines the card’s limit, the financing scale, and maintenance costs.
  • The amount of the card is adjustable for marginal farmers, which ranges from ₹10,000 to ₹50,000.
  • The maximum limit of the Agribazaar Kisan Safalta Card can be increased annually based on crop yield and repayments.
  • The repayment plan can be rescheduled if crop damage occurs as a result of natural disasters.
  • Once the harvest is completed, farmers can repay the loan.
